Stonebow

Cost: 35 gp
Weight: 4 lbs.
Damage: 1d4 (small), 1d6 (medium)
Critical: x2
Range: 50 ft.
Type: Bashing
Category: Ranged Weapons
Proficiency: Simple
Weapon Groups Bows
Special:
  A stonebow, or bullet crossbow, resembles a Light Crossbow except for the distinct U-shaped bend in the stock.
  Instead of bolts, the stonebow shoots sling bullets. The bow has two strings with a leather pocket between them to hold the bullet.
  Loading: Loading a stonebow is a Move Action (a Free Action if you have the Rapid Reload feat) that provokes attacks of opportunity.
  Firing: You can shoot, but not load, a stonebow with one hand, but doing so imposes a –2 penalty on your attack rolls. You can shoot a stonebow with each hand, but you take a penalty on attack rolls as if attacking with two light weapons. This penalty is cumulative with the penalty for firing one-handed.
  You can shoot ordinary stones with a stonebow, but stones aren’t as dense or as round as bullets. When using stones, you take a –1 penalty on attack rolls and deal damage as if the weapon were designed for a creature one size category smaller than you.
